Most GIS applications described in the literature are based on the first two strategies. Binary Models A binary model uses logical expressions to select map features from a composite map. The output of a binary model is in binary format: 1 …

WebSuitability models can help you find optimal locations. But what if you merely want to identify locations or areas that meet all the criteria for your analysis—such as code requirements, permit restrictions, or minimum feasibility conditions? WebTwo data models commonly used to represent spatial data in GIS are the raster and vector data models Within the vector data model, a representation of the world is created using lines, points, and polygons. Vector data is focused on modeling discrete features with precise shapes and boundaries. -A home becomes a point-A river becomes a line WebJan 24, 2024 · The more training samples we create, the more effective our model will be.
